Marlly's story
Marlly is a tour guide from Medellín, Antioquia, with 10 years of experience. She runs a business focused on promoting sustainable local tourism, which includes visits to the main emblematic sites of Antioquia, cultural tours, and group guidance; additionally, she sells typical regional souvenirs such as handicrafts, representative keepsakes, and items related to local culture, which complement her income.
Marlly is a single mother and lives with her son in a house gifted by her mother, from where she organizes her daily activity and is the main provider for the household.
A loan of $5,112,806 COP allows Marlly to acquire new souvenirs to expand the variety of products she offers to tourists and improve availability during tours. This investment strengthens her commercial activity, increases her income, and allows her to consolidate her sustainable local tourism business while ensuring the well-being of her family.
